Manchester City are eyeing Cesc Fàbregas as a surprise candidate to succeed Pep Guardiola when the iconic manager eventually leaves the Etihad, FootballTransfers understands. Article continues under the videoFabregas has only just finished his first full season as a manager, after initially being part of the coaching team that got Como promoted to Serie A during the 2023/24 season, and he has already developed a reputation as one of the brightest young coaches in Europe.

Aston Villa are growing increasingly concerned that Arsenal are preparing a formal move for attacking midfielder Morgan Rogers, and the Midlands club has now stepped-up efforts to secure Eberechi Eze from Crystal Palace as a contingency plan. Article continues under the videoFootballTransfers understands that Villa are aware of Arsenal’s escalating interest in Rogers, who has enjoyed a meteoric rise since joining from Middlesbrough.

Tottenham Hotspur head coach Thomas Frank has wasted no time in laying the groundwork for his summer recruitment drive. Article continues under the videoSources have confirmed to FootballTransfers that Frank, who was officially unveiled as Spurs’ new boss last week on a contract running until 2028, has already held extensive discussions with the club's decision-makers over key transfer targets - and Jack Grealish has been a prominent name in those conversations.

FootballTransfers understands that Manchester United have held direct talks with the representatives of Juventus striker Dusan Vlahovic as the club intensify efforts to add a reliable No.9 this summer. Article continues under the videoThe 25-year-old is entering the final year of his contract in Turin, and with no renewal in sight, Juventus are once again open to a sale in a bid to get his hefty salary off the wage bill.
